Abstract
MICs of DU-6859a, a novel fluoroquinolone, for 18 Klebsiella pneumonia e isolates and 21 Enterobacter cloacae isolates with altered GyrA or a ltered GyrA and ParC ranged from less than or equal to 0.025 to 6.25 m u g/ml and from 0.1 to 3.13 mu g/ml respectively. Based on the MICs at which 90% of the isolates were inhibited for these strains of K. pneu moniae and E. cloacae, DU-6859a exhibited 16- to 256-fold-greater acti vity than currently available fluoroquinolones.
